Angular常用插件汇总:UI框架、弹出对话框到日期选择

需积分: 33 14 下载量 135 浏览量 更新于2024-07-20 收藏 362KB PDF 举报
在Angular开发中,插件的使用极大地丰富了前端开发者的工具箱,使得项目更加高效和灵活。本文档主要介绍了六个常用的Angular插件,涵盖了UI框架、对话框、弹出面板、内容编辑、剪贴板以及日期处理等关键领域。 首先,我们关注于UI框架,Angular社区提供了多个选项来加速开发过程。如angular-bootstrap和angular-strap是基于Bootstrap的轻量级UI组件库,它们为Angular应用添加了Bootstrap的样式和交互效果。另外,angular-material和lumX则是Angular Material Design风格的解决方案,为现代化的Web应用提供了丰富的组件。ionic和mobile-angular-ui则专注于移动端开发,提供了针对移动设备优化的UI组件。 对于对话框的需求,ngDialog是一个推荐使用的插件,以其优雅简洁的设计受到开发者喜爱。ngDialog和angular-dialog-service都是用于弹出对话框的解决方案,前者功能强大,后者则建立在angular-bootstrap的modal基础上。v-modal提供了一个简单、灵活且美观的模态对话框,而ngSweetAlert则是Angular封装的SweetAlert替代品,提供更优雅的警告或确认提示。 在弹出面板方面,nsPopover可以作为popover、tooltip或dropdown使用,满足多种显示需求。ng-pageslide是一个侧滑面板插件,适用于需要类似工作tile或teambition布局的应用场景,但仅作为指令提供,缺乏服务支持。 内容编辑是界面交互的重要部分,angular-xeditable允许在表格中展示和编辑文本,与其他插件如多选和日期选择插件无缝集成。angular-contenteditable则专为contenteditable属性设计的Angular模型,增强了页面内容的可编辑性。 剪贴板功能在现代Web应用中越来越常见,有angular-zeroclipboard、ng-clip和angular-clipboard这三个插件,它们提供了复制、粘贴等基本操作的简化处理。 日期处理上,angular-bootstrap-d可能是指某个特定的日期选择插件,它可能整合了Bootstrap的日期选择器或者提供了自定义日期功能。这个插件能够方便地在Angular应用中实现日期相关的用户交互。 这些Angular插件的使用不仅提升了开发效率,还优化了用户体验,是Angular开发者必备的工具集。通过了解并熟练运用这些插件,开发者能够更好地构建出功能完善、响应灵敏的Web应用。